Kolte-Patil Developers targets ₹6,000 crore revenue from six MMR redevelopment projects

Pune-based realty firm Kolte-Patil Developers said on Thursday it expects a combined estimated revenue potential of ₹6,000 crore from six society redevelopment projects it has added across the Mumbai Metropolitan Region (MMR). In a regulatory filing, the company said the projects would be launched in 6-12 months, according to a PTI report published on August 6, 2026.

Six redevelopment projects across the MMR

Kolte-Patil Developers said it will redevelop six societies across prime locations in the MMR. The projects are located in Santacruz West, Andheri West (Lokhandwala), Oshiwara, Versova, Ghatkopar East and Vashi.

The combined estimated revenue potential of the six projects is ₹6,000 crore, the company said.

Existing portfolio and execution scale

Kolte-Patil Developers Ltd has completed over 68 projects, including residential complexes, integrated townships, commercial complexes and IT parks, covering a saleable area of more than 33 million square feet across Pune, Mumbai and Bengaluru, the company said in the same filing.

Blackstone strategic partnership

In the 2025-26 fiscal, Kolte-Patil entered into a strategic partnership with global investment firm Blackstone, which acquired a 40 per cent stake in the real estate firm, according to the filing. The stake acquisition was reported by PTI alongside the company's MMR expansion announcement.
